OpenAI’s Codex Gets a Major Upgrade — And It’s Gunning for Claude Code
The AI coding assistant landscape just got a lot more competitive. OpenAI has rolled out a significant update to its Codex platform, introducing capabilities that directly challenge Anthropic’s Claude Code — currently the market leader in autonomous coding agents. The update brings computer-use functionality and integrated image generation, transforming Codex from a code-generation tool into a full-stack development agent.
This isn’t just an incremental improvement. It represents a fundamental shift in how OpenAI envisions AI-assisted software development, and it has immediate implications for developers choosing between the major AI coding platforms.

What’s New in the Latest Codex Update
OpenAI’s latest Codex update introduces several headline features that bridge the gap between coding assistance and autonomous development:
- Computer Use (GUI Control): Codex can now interact with graphical user interfaces — clicking buttons, navigating menus, and controlling desktop applications. This means it can operate tools that lack APIs, handle visual testing workflows, and interact with legacy systems that were previously off-limits to AI agents.
- Integrated Image Generation: Developers can now generate UI mockups, design assets, and visual documentation directly within the coding workflow. This eliminates the context-switching between coding tools and design platforms.
- Enhanced Multi-File Editing: Improved ability to understand and modify large codebases across multiple files simultaneously, with better dependency tracking and conflict resolution.
- Improved Context Window: Extended context handling allows Codex to process larger codebases and maintain coherence across complex refactoring tasks.
These additions directly address the capabilities that made Claude Code the preferred choice for many developers. Anthropic’s offering had established a commanding lead in autonomous coding tasks, particularly in its ability to navigate complex codebases and perform multi-step refactoring with minimal human guidance.
The Claude Code Benchmark
To understand why this update matters, it’s worth examining what Claude Code brought to the market. Released as part of Anthropic’s broader Claude ecosystem, Claude Code offers:
- Autonomous code understanding and modification across entire repositories
- Terminal command execution with safety guardrails
- Integrated debugging and test-running capabilities
- Natural language interface for complex development tasks
According to industry analysis, Claude Code rapidly gained adoption among professional developers. In benchmark evaluations across common development tasks — including bug fixing, feature implementation, and code review — Claude Code consistently scored in the top tier among AI coding assistants.
OpenAI’s strategy with the new Codex update appears to be: match Claude Code’s core capabilities, then differentiate through multimodal features that Claude doesn’t yet offer natively.
Computer Use: The Game-Changing Addition
The most significant addition is computer-use capability. This allows Codex to:
- Interact with web browsers for automated testing and web scraping
- Control IDE features that aren’t exposed through APIs
- Manipulate design tools like Figma or Sketch for UI-related tasks
- Handle GUI-based legacy applications in enterprise environments
Computer use represents a paradigm shift in AI agents. Instead of being limited to text-based interfaces and APIs, the AI can now interact with software the same way a human does — through the graphical interface. This opens up entirely new categories of automation.
This capability was first demonstrated by Anthropic in late 2024, but OpenAI’s integration into a coding-focused product is notable. It suggests a future where AI developers can not only write code but also visually verify its output, test UI components, and interact with the full software stack.
Image Generation: Bridging Design and Development
The integrated image generation feature addresses a long-standing gap in AI-assisted development. Historically, developers working on frontend projects needed to:
- Switch between code editors and design tools
- Manually translate design specifications into CSS and HTML
- Source or create visual assets separately
With image generation built into Codex, developers can describe a UI component in natural language and receive both the code and a visual mockup simultaneously. This accelerates the design-to-code pipeline and enables rapid prototyping that wasn’t possible before.
For solo developers and small teams, this capability could effectively substitute for a dedicated designer in early-stage projects, significantly reducing time-to-market for new products.
Pricing and Accessibility
One area where OpenAI has historically competed aggressively is pricing. While specific pricing details for the updated Codex tier continue to evolve, OpenAI’s pattern suggests competitive pricing aimed at undercutting premium alternatives while maintaining profitability through volume.
Claude Code, by contrast, is bundled into Anthropic’s Max and Team plans, which are positioned as premium offerings. For individual developers and startups watching their tooling budgets, OpenAI’s pricing strategy could be the deciding factor.
What This Means for Developers
The intensifying competition between OpenAI and Anthropic in the AI coding space is good news for developers. Here’s what to consider:
- Evaluate based on your stack: If your work involves significant GUI testing, legacy system integration, or design-to-code workflows, the updated Codex’s computer-use and image-generation features may give it an edge.
- Don’t bet on a single tool: The best developers are already using multiple AI coding assistants for different tasks. Claude Code may excel at pure code reasoning while Codex shines in multimodal workflows.
- Watch for open-source alternatives: The open-source coding agent ecosystem — including tools built on open-weight models — is advancing rapidly. The gap between proprietary and open-source AI coding tools is narrowing with each release cycle.
- Security considerations: Both Claude Code and Codex require broad access to your development environment. Evaluate the security model of each platform carefully, especially when granting computer-use permissions that could interact with sensitive systems.
The Broader AI Agent Race
This Codex update is part of a much larger trend. We’re witnessing the evolution of AI from conversational assistants to autonomous agents that can execute complex, multi-step tasks across digital environments. The implications extend far beyond software development:
- Enterprise automation: Computer-use AI agents could automate workflows involving legacy software, ERP systems, and custom business applications.
- Quality assurance: Automated UI testing powered by computer-use agents could replace manual QA for many common scenarios.
- Customer support: Agents that can navigate interfaces on behalf of users could transform support operations.
OpenAI and Anthropic are racing to define what an AI agent looks like. The winner won’t necessarily be the one with the smartest model — it will be the one whose agent can most reliably and safely execute real-world tasks.
